An exhilarating journey awaits with the ATV & Buggy Adventure Tour in Punta Cana. Set off from a traditional ranch in Macao and navigate through muddy trails and lush tropical landscapes. Discover local culture with tastings of Dominican coffee, cacao, and mamajuana before splashing into a crystal-clear cenote. Relax at Macao Beach, one of the region's most stunning shorelines, where you can soak in the sun or snap memorable photos. This immersive experience, led by knowledgeable guides, promises a unique blend of adventure and local flavor.

Drive through Bávaro, the vibrant heart of Punta Cana, famous for its endless palm trees, beachfront resorts, and lively Caribbean atmosphere. Enjoy scenic views and get a glimpse of local life as your adventure begins with tropical energy all around.
Visit a traditional Dominican ranch where your ATV or Buggy adventure begins. Meet your local guide, receive safety instructions, and learn about local products such as coffee, cacao, and mamajuana. This authentic countryside stop offers a taste of real Dominican culture before you hit the trails.
Take a refreshing break at Los Hoyos del Salado, a beautiful natural cenote surrounded by lush tropical vegetation. Its crystal-clear waters make it the perfect spot for a quick swim or to capture stunning photos during your off-road journey.
Relax at the stunning Macao Beach, one of Punta Cana’s most iconic shorelines. Enjoy the ocean breeze, walk along the golden sand, or take memorable photos by the turquoise water — the perfect ending to your family-friendly adventure.
